The Hyatt Regency Waikiki Beach Resort & Spa is a premier hotel established in the heart of Waikiki, Hawaii, featuring an expansive 1230-room property. This luxurious resort is situated just steps away from the azure, blue waters and soft sands of Waikiki Beach, promising guests an idyllic beachfront experience. The hotel enjoys a prime location directly across from the world-famous Duke Kahanamoku Statue, near the iconic Diamond Head Crater, and centrally positioned within a vibrant city center, making it an ideal destination for both leisure and business travelers. Offering a blend of traditional Hawaiian hospitality and modern amenities, Hyatt Regency Waikiki Beach Resort & Spa prides itself on providing personalized services characterized by the spirit of Aloha. The property showcases a variety of cultural activities, a refreshing swimming pool overlooking the Pacific Ocean, locally sourced dining specialties, and unique on-site boutiques that enhance the guest experience. The Assistant Director of Food and Beverage at Hyatt Regency Waikiki Beach Resort & Spa plays a crucial role in managing and steering the diverse Food and Beverage divisions within the hotel. This executive position involves oversight of Banquets, Restaurants, and various Food and Beverage outlets, ensuring that all operations maintain Hyatt's high standards of quality and service. The role requires a strategic leader capable of handling both short and long-term planning, budgeting, and marketing initiatives related to food and beverage services. The Assistant Director is responsible for fostering employee development through recruiting, coaching, performance evaluations, and training, thereby building a motivated and competent team. Additionally, this role requires close coordination with other hotel departments to deliver seamless guest service experiences. The responsibilities also include quality control, payroll management, inventory oversight, and ensuring compliance with health regulations and corporate standards. Hyundai Regency Waikiki offers a competitive salary range for this role, spanning $110,700 to $125,000 annually, reflecting the seniority and responsibilities entrusted to the position. This role is ideal for a dynamic, entrepreneurial-minded leader who thrives in a high-volume, high-expectation hospitality environment and who is committed to upholding the spirit and tradition of Hyatt's renowned service excellence.
